Transaction 51e3659a5df102174dbc6208b91e098af1cfc470f4194c5a3dff08caa8a6390b
1 Input
2 Outputs
- 51e3659a5df102174dbc6208b91e098af1cfc470f4194c5a3dff08caa8a6390b:0
- 51e3659a5df102174dbc6208b91e098af1cfc470f4194c5a3dff08caa8a6390b:1
value 23365589
address 16yfiW4NAv8hjsMDquGq87UVWQZiucpNCp
value 1242811828
address 37NZQWs5m63v59UMSLJ7qSUR1nR7gSuR6h